Exciting morning in Louisiana!

The day started normally, coffee, oatmeal, and packing up, and then we started biking out of Chicot SP. The way out is actuallu through the park so we had a nice ride through a luscious forest on a quiet paved road. And then we saw our first alligator! The road went over a bridge, over a bayou with trees growing in the water, with cranes, turtles and yes, alligaors! I'm glad I didn't know about the alligators before we went to bed.
The excitement continued when we went to the small town post office just outside the park to send our cold weather gear back home. When I put my gear on the counter, I felt a sting and all of a sudden there was a huge caterpillar sitting on the counter next to my gear. It must have hitched a ride from the camp ground. The lady at the post office was as surprised as I was. She said it was a stinging caterpillar, and seemed surprised I'd never seen one before.

Now we are eating chinese food in a small town the road. Its takeout only, but they set up a table so we could eat inside (in the air conditioning). We must look weird to the other customers coming in for pickup.

Its not even noon and we've already seen so much and met so many people!
